How do you attach Fibreglass or Carbon fibre A Panels And Rear Valences to your mini?

Do you bolt it on or something?

rear valance would be bolted into place as said, im not sure how the a-pannels would be attached as they are usualy hammerd around and spot welded, im guessing would be bonded on such as sikaflex how ever its spelt :D that stuff doesnt come off very easy and sure to stick on the a pannels easy
